high-dose folic acid supplements might INCREASE cancer risk

New evidence suggests that high-dose folic acid supplements might INCREASE cancer risk.

Several years ago, high-dose folic acid plus other B vitamins (Foltx, etc) were commonly used in patients with heart disease.

These vitamins lower homocysteine...but they DON'T improve cardiovascular outcomes. So this practice fell by the wayside.
